We are currently looking for a passionate Restaurant Manager to join our lovely team at The Begging Bowl in Peckham. Our FOH are known for their friendly, warm and knowledgeable service and we are looking for someone who is a genuine people person, who loves food and has great organisation and attention to detail. You will need at least 1 year of management experience.
The Begging Bowl is an independent modern Thai restaurant which opened in 2012 by Jamie Younger. Our kitchen serves exciting dishes for sharing using a combination of quality local produce, authentic Thai ingredients and traditional Thai processes. All our pastes and sauces are made from scratch down to our homemade coconut cream. We are a small team and you will have plenty of room to share your ideas and grow within the restaurant.
We offer a great work-life balance with 28 days holiday a year including 4 days for Christmas and New Year's Day off. We also offer a 50% discount for you and a friend when dining once a month.
